[all-commits] [llvm/llvm-project] 5e67ae: [BOLT][RISCV] Implement return/unconditional branc...

Job Noorman via All-commits all-commits at lists.llvm.org
Wed Jun 21 01:21:25 PDT 2023


  Branch: refs/heads/main
  Home:   https://github.com/llvm/llvm-project
  Commit: 5e67ae151e7d282eed7426c1c227ef8abc1c5a92
      https://github.com/llvm/llvm-project/commit/5e67ae151e7d282eed7426c1c227ef8abc1c5a92
  Author: Job Noorman <jnoorman at igalia.com>
  Date:   2023-06-21 (Wed, 21 Jun 2023)

  Changed paths:
    M bolt/lib/Target/RISCV/RISCVMCPlusBuilder.cpp

  Log Message:
  -----------
  [BOLT][RISCV] Implement return/unconditional branch creation

Reviewed By: rafauler

Differential Revision: https://reviews.llvm.org/D153342


  Commit: 41b8aed499b13c093fae7d3659d93d3fb636f07b
      https://github.com/llvm/llvm-project/commit/41b8aed499b13c093fae7d3659d93d3fb636f07b
  Author: Job Noorman <jnoorman at igalia.com>
  Date:   2023-06-21 (Wed, 21 Jun 2023)

  Changed paths:
    M bolt/lib/Target/RISCV/RISCVMCPlusBuilder.cpp

  Log Message:
  -----------
  [BOLT][RISCV] Implement branch reversal

Reviewed By: rafauler

Differential Revision: https://reviews.llvm.org/D153344


  Commit: b6556dc9fe2d8b87fcbc993daa2335b9656b1bc7
      https://github.com/llvm/llvm-project/commit/b6556dc9fe2d8b87fcbc993daa2335b9656b1bc7
  Author: Job Noorman <jnoorman at igalia.com>
  Date:   2023-06-21 (Wed, 21 Jun 2023)

  Changed paths:
    M bolt/lib/Target/RISCV/RISCVMCPlusBuilder.cpp

  Log Message:
  -----------
  [BOLT][RISCV] Fix implementation of getTargetSymbol

- Correctly handle OpNum == 0 (auto select operand)
- Implement MCExpr overload

Reviewed By: rafauler

Differential Revision: https://reviews.llvm.org/D153343


Compare: https://github.com/llvm/llvm-project/compare/1b9b78fd481a...b6556dc9fe2d


More information about the All-commits mailing list